A "La Vitrioleuse" color etching on paper by Eugène Grasset in 1894. Monogrammed "EtG" in the bottom right of the composition, under it a lead pencil signature "EGrasset n°35" plus a dry stamp on the bottom left.
23,43 x 17,13 inch
(slighly tear)
Bibliography :
- Paul Greenhalgh: "L'Art Nouveau en Europe", La Renaissance du Livre, 2002, print reproduced on page 151 as number 9.4.
